Well stocked beer fridge can surely attract many brew thieves, especially ones at home waiting for you to leave for office. To fight off such beer mongers, Germany-based Peter Gotting has invented a revolutionary underground beer cooler that reserves and saves your favorite drink from beer lovers.
Gotting posted a video online to show his latest invention, an underground beer cooler/fridge cleverly hidden under flowerpot placed in his backyard. Brilliantly designed as three-tier fridge, it rests beneath a beautifully decorated terracotta flowerpot with a healthy plant.
The video shows how by pulling a small lever, the fridge slowly emerges from the ground holding more than 30 chilled beers to enjoy on a sunny day. Peter Gotting’s invention is an impressive work of art, as once the lever is pressed again; fridge closes and leaves no trace behind.
